The concept of a feedback loop is fundamental in many fields, including psychology, engineering, and business. It describes a process where the output of a system influences its own input, creating a cycle that can either reinforce or diminish certain behaviors or outcomes.

What Is a Feedback Loop?

A feedback loop occurs when the results of a process are fed back into the system, affecting future outputs. There are two main types: positive feedback, which amplifies changes, and negative feedback, which stabilizes the system.

Examples of Feedback Loops

  • Climate Change: Rising temperatures lead to melting ice, which reduces Earth’s reflectivity and causes further warming.
  • Business: Customer satisfaction can lead to increased sales, which provide more resources for improvement, further boosting satisfaction.
  • Biology: Blood sugar regulation involves negative feedback to maintain stable glucose levels.

Why Breaking a Feedback Loop Matters

Uncontrolled positive feedback loops can lead to undesirable outcomes, such as environmental degradation or economic bubbles. Recognizing and intervening in these loops is essential for maintaining balance and stability.

Strategies to Break or Modify Feedback Loops

  • Identify the Loop: Understand which processes are reinforcing each other.
  • Introduce Negative Feedback: Implement controls that counteract excessive growth or decline.
  • Change System Dynamics: Alter the structure or parameters to prevent harmful reinforcement.
  • Monitor and Adjust: Continuously observe the system and make adjustments as needed.

Breaking a feedback loop requires awareness and deliberate intervention. By understanding how these cycles operate, individuals and organizations can create more sustainable and resilient systems.
